Private EDWARD RYLEY HULME

Service Number: 316815
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Royal Welsh Fusiliers

23rd Bn.

Date of Death

Died 28 December 1918

Age 26 years old

Buried or commemorated at

LONGUENESSE (ST. OMER) SOUVENIR CEMETERY

V. E. 85.

France

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Secondary Unit, Regiment transf. to (477719) 753rd Area Employment Coy. Labour Corps
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Son of Mrs. Lucy Ryley, of 5, George St., Brook St., Macclesfield.
  • Personal Inscription UNTIL WE MEET AGAIN
